Transaction 29e990879123384de6273eac8cc41f11868502e74d9778358fb358bf679a64a3

1 Input
2 Outputs
  • 29e990879123384de6273eac8cc41f11868502e74d9778358fb358bf679a64a3:0
  • value  445875
    address  bc1q8asyqm27w7yrxtmtep8tqxx5kffxddcxn5mafw
  • 29e990879123384de6273eac8cc41f11868502e74d9778358fb358bf679a64a3:1
  • value  159078
    address  16QVzsPs4Lhj4XTknRbyCuNHdEa2PL6q4a